Newt Graham Lake is a cultural feature (reservoir) in Wagoner County. The primary coordinates for Newt Graham Lake places it within the OK 74014 ZIP Code delivery area.

Description: | Formed by damming the Verdigris River 6.7 mi SSW of Inola |
History: | "Named by Congressional Action, Public Law 91-585, Dec. 24, 1970, for Newt Graham (1883-1957), Long called the ""Lone Voice"" pushing for AR River" |
